Andrea, I found this in the 1850 Census: New London Township, Huron County, Ohio enumerated 16 July 1850 on page following the one stamped 338 Russel KNOWLTON 37 m New York farmer Lorana KNOWLTON 38 f New York Sherman KNOWLTON 15 m New York Henry A. KNOWLTON 12 m Ohio Asael KNOWLTON 9 m New York Tasey L. KNOWLTON 2 f Ohio Lorana might be Lovana, but there's no way I can get Lavina out of it. It's too clearly written. I also found one Russel KNOWLTON in the 1840 Census. He is in Poultney, Steuben Co., NY. 1 male < 5 1 male 5 < 10 1 male and 1 female 20 < 30 ---- Bill Message text written by INTERNET:KNOWLTON-L@rootsweb.com >I'm interested in Knowltons that imigrated from NY to Ohio. I found him on the 1880 and 1870 censuses in Ohio and in Kansas. But he should show up in Ohio in 1860 with wife Susan and little Spencer aged 1. Nowhere to be seen. I even did searches on all the Shermans and all the Knowltons from NY and all sorts of other things. Since they were in Huron Co in 1880, I did even wilder searches in that county in 1860, but no go. This is not the Sherman b 1848 who appears in Stocking. I do not have access to the 1850 census, but perhaps somone could check Ohio for Knowltons b NY in that year--although there is no guarantee he had left NY yet. I would begin collecting all the records available in Crawford Co, KS, ca 1870, and those in Huron Co., OH, later. Purdy is an old NY name, so there may be Purdys back in the family--I refer to son Purdy age 13 in 1880. I did find Sherman's wife in 1900 DIVORCED and working as a servant in Huron Co.
